Why your association needs to adopt a data governance policy

Nimble AMS

A well-executed data governance policy will often include a steering committee or leadership board to determine the data standards and discuss the implementation process and enforcement procedures. Additionally, consider who will make up your data governance body if you choose to create a committee or leadership board.

Developing My Dream Association

Smooth The Path

One of the core staff values would be to be intensely member-focused. We would talk with members often, conduct listening tours, and interview them. We would use all the member insights we gain to develop our member communications, set our strategy, and create an innovation plan. What would you do?

Growth Hacking Your Community with Vanessa DiMauro

Higher Logic

Growth matters: five member engagement hacks. Every community’s growth path is different, but here are some member engagement hacks to test out: The importance of outreach. Try to segment members and engage with them differently (new members, active stars, fallen angels, silent readers, etc.).
